Check wheel alignment if the swing arm is removed by raising the car and removing the rear wheel. Support the rear wheel bearing carrier with a suitable jack, then remove the coil spring. If equipped, remove the ride height sensor. Next, remove the lower shock absorber fastener, followed by the lower shock absorber mount fasteners to take off the mount. Mark the eccentric washer location on the subframe, then remove the fasteners and eccentric washer to take out the swing arm from the vehicle. For installation, reverse the removal process, ensuring the subframe swing arm fastener head faces the rear of the vehicle, using new self-locking nuts. Tighten the fasteners to final torque only after the vehicle has been lowered and the suspension has settled. Have the car professionally aligned when the job is complete.
